site stats

How java is different from c and c++

Web6 dec. 2024 · Some of the differences between Java and C++ are more nuanced than others. Java is not compatible with other languages, despite being inspired by C and C++. C is a programming language that is compatible with most high-level programming languages. It's easy to make patches or supplements of client-side code with C++. WebC++ has a great deal of mix-matched code that it inherited from relics of the past and carry-overs from C. As a result, it's huge, weirdly complex, and has a great deal of non-obvious syntax. Java's syntax is far simpler, in comparison. Java runs on the JVM. Most optimization is done in the JVM by a JIT compiler.

How to Learn C and C++ Programming: The Ultimate Resource List

WebThe main difference between C/C++ and Java is how they are compiled. While programs in C++ like its predecessor are compiled into object codes, source codes in Java are bytecodes. C++ is completely a compiled language while Java is both compiled and interpreted. Now, let us check some more fundamental differences between C++ and … Web12 apr. 2024 · The big difference between C++ and C# is that C# doesn't allow you to choose how to allocate memory for a particular instance. For example, in C++ you wished to do this: Int* pj=new int(30); Myclass Mine; This will cause the int to be allocated on the heap, and the Myclass instance to be allocated on the stack. birth in the united states https://lt80lightkit.com

Understanding the Differences Between C#, C++, and C

WebContrast Between Java And C++ Object-oriented: Java – Java, like C++, is an OO language. In Java, everything is an object except for the most fundamental types. Exceptions include strings and numbers. Strings and integers are two examples of exceptions to this rule. Web10 jul. 2013 · In C and C++, the primitive variables are nothing more than named cells in the memory. In Java, the primitive types are the same, but you also can use the wrappers (for example, java.lang.Integer) that provide a lot of extra … Web30 sep. 2024 · C, C++, and Java are three languages that have defined programming paradigms with time and yet hold great value in the market. In this article, I will be comparing the differences between C, C++ and Java so you can choose one or more for a probable career or a certification. Differences between C, C++ and Java birth into being movie

DIFFERENCES BETWEEN C , C++ , JAVA , PYTHON - YouTube

Category:Difference between C and C++ - GeeksforGeeks

Tags:How java is different from c and c++

How java is different from c and c++

Similarities and Difference between Java and C

Web12 dec. 2024 · The concepts discussed above are briefly summarised to clearly highlight the major difference between C and C++. C. C++. C is a Procedural Programming Language, so it follows the approaches to prioritize procedure over data. C++ is an Object-Oriented Programming Language, so it gives prime consideration to the data. Web21 sep. 2024 · C vs C++: The 10 Core Differences. As discussed earlier, both C and C++ are general-purpose, procedural languages. However, the core difference between C and C++ is that the C programming language does not allow class and object whereas C++ is an object-oriented programming language. Let's find out the core differences between C …

How java is different from c and c++

Did you know?

Web26 mei 2024 · Answer: The main difference between C++ and Java is that C++ is only a compiled language while Java is both compiled and interpreted. The C++ compiler … Web27 mei 2024 · One difference between C++ and Java is that C++ is closest to machine language, which makes it much more viable for software that needs to run quickly and …

Web15 sep. 2024 · C++ and Java resemble the syntax of C programming language. However, the ecosystems of Java and C++ are very different. C++ code can be called into C, C++ libraries, or API of operating systems. On the other hand, Java code is only ideal for Java-based libraries. In addition, C++ interacts with hardware more effectively than Java due … Web8 jan. 2024 · C does no support polymorphism, encapsulation, and inheritance which means that C does not support object oriented programming. C++ supports polymorphism, …

WebDIFFERECES BETWEEN PROGRAMMING LANGUAGES WebDifference between C, C++ and Java easy & simple tutorial CS Engineering Gyan 75.4K subscribers Subscribe 684 Share 36K views 1 year ago What are the Difference Between.. Main...

Web6 apr. 2024 · List and vector are both container classes in C++, but they have fundamental differences in the way they store and manipulate data. List stores elements in a linked list structure, while vector stores elements in a dynamically allocated array. Each container has its own advantages and disadvantages, and choosing the right container that depends ...

Web18 jan. 2024 · C++ filled the need for object-oriented programming within C. C# was built on the success of this and Java, another popular object-oriented language. Important Features of C++ Some of the main features of C++ include the combination of being an object-oriented language and offering class functionality, which is why it was originally … birth in water videoWeb19 mrt. 2014 · The Arduino language is C++, but it is very different from most C++ varieties. The Arduino language has a lot of abstraction built in, especially in the hardware interfaces, which makes it very simple to use. If you have a background in Java, C and C++ should be very similar. The main differences between Arduino and C++ are in the … dappy willyWebC++ is mainly used for system programming. Java is mainly used for application programming. It is widely used in Windows-based, web-based, enterprise, and mobile … birth iphoneケースWeb18 mrt. 2024 · C++ and Java both are object-oriented programming languages. Yet, both languages differ from each other in many ways. C++ is derived from C and has the … birth irelanddapr app channel is not initializedWeb30 mrt. 2024 · Main Differences Between Java and C++ Java uses both a compiler and an interpreter, whereas C++ only uses a compiler. Java only allows for method overloading, … birth in tv showsWeb13 apr. 2024 · C++ : Is there any difference between the Java and C++ operators?To Access My Live Chat Page, On Google, Search for "hows tech developer connect"As promised,... da praying clock